Oclusión de las arterias retinianas - Prevención

Nombres alternativos

Oclusión de la arteria retiniana central; Oclusión de la ramificación de la arteria retiniana; CRAO; BRAO

Prevención:

Las medidas empleadas para prevenir otras enfermedades de los vasos sanguíneos (vasculares), como la arteriopatía coronaria, pueden disminuir el riesgo de oclusión de las arterias retinianas. Estas medidas abarcan:

  • Consumir una dieta baja en grasas
  • Hacer ejercicio
  • Dejar de fumar
  • Bajar de peso en caso de tener sobrepeso

La aspirina se emplea con frecuencia para evitar que la arteria se vuelva a bloquear nuevamente. También sirve el control de la fibrilación auricular.
